The Various Sorts Of Stomach Tucks
When thinking about an abdominoplasty, it is essential to know that there are numerous kinds created to attend to various requirements and choices. The complete belly tuck, or abdominoplasty, includes a bigger laceration and gets rid of excess skin and fat from the entire stomach location. A miniature belly put could be the ideal choice if you're primarily worried concerning the location listed below your belly switch. This choice needs a smaller sized laceration and concentrates on the lower abdomen.
For those that've had several pregnancies or substantial weight-loss, a circumferential stomach put can give a more detailed solution by lifting the abdomen, buttocks, and thighs. Lastly, if you're searching for subtle changes, a non-surgical abdominoplasty could be a choice, utilizing methods like liposuction or skin tightening up. Recognizing these options can help you pick the finest method for your body and objectives.

Surgical Dangers Entailed
While an abdominoplasty can enhance your body contour, it is necessary to be knowledgeable about the medical risks involved. Issues can arise during or after the treatment, consisting of infection, bleeding, and anesthesia-related problems. You could experience damaging responses to medications or embolism, which can be serious. There's additionally the opportunity of inadequate wound recovery, resulting in scars that may not discolor as preferred. Fluid build-up under the skin, called seroma, can happen and might require drain. Additionally, some individuals report dissatisfaction with their outcomes, which can result in additional treatments. Recognizing these risks is vital in making an informed decision about your tummy put and ensuring you're gotten ready for the trip ahead.

Healing Refine After a Belly Tuck
As you start your recuperation after an abdominoplasty, it is necessary to comprehend what to expect throughout this healing procedure. You'll experience swelling, wounding, and pain, which is typical. Your doctor will certainly provide certain instructions on discomfort administration, consisting of medicines to assist alleviate any discomfort.
For the very first few days, you'll need to rest and stay clear of arduous tasks. It's necessary to maintain your lacerations completely dry and tidy to stop infection. You'll likely use a compression garment to support your abdominal area and decrease swelling.
Follow-up appointments are vital to guarantee proper healing. Most individuals can return to work in regarding two to four weeks, but complete healing might take a number of months.

How Lengthy Does a Tummy Tuck Procedure Normally Take?
A belly tuck treatment normally takes concerning two to 5 hours, relying on the intricacy. You'll intend to plan for a healing duration later, which can significantly affect your total timeline and healing process.
Will a Tummy Put Influence My Ability to Get Expecting?
A belly tuck won't straight impact your capacity to get expecting, yet it can alter your stomach muscular tissues and skin. Think about going over timing with your cosmetic surgeon ahead of time. if pregnancy is in your future strategies.
Can I Combine a Stomach Put With Various Other Surgical Procedures?
Yes, you can integrate a belly put with other surgeries, like lipo or bust augmentation. Reviewing your particular goals and health and wellness with your doctor's essential to guarantee security and ideal results.
What Is the Cost Array for a Stomach Tuck?
An abdominoplasty normally expenses in between $6,000 and $12,000. Variables like your area, specialist's experience, and details procedure details can influence the last cost. Always talk to your cosmetic surgeon for a precise quote.
Are Belly Tuck Results Permanent?
Abdominoplasty outcomes can be lasting, but they aren't completely irreversible. If you obtain or lose substantial weight, or experience maternity, your outcomes could alter. Maintaining a steady weight aids preserve your new appearance.
